Company Description

Zurich-based green-tech company Hitachi Zosen Inova (HZI) is a global leader in solutions for energy transition and circular economy including Waste to Energy and Renewable Gas (RG), operating as part of the Hitachi Zosen Corporation Group. HZI acts as a project developer, technology supplier and engineering, procurement and construction (EPC) contractor delivering complete turnkey plants and system solutions for thermal and biological waste recovery. Its solutions are based on efficient and environmentally sound technologies, are thoroughly tested, and can be flexibly adapted to customer requirements. HZI's Service Solutions Group combines its own research and development with comprehensive manufacturing and erection capabilities to provide support throughout a plant's entire plant cycle. HZI works for customers ranging from established waste management companies to up-and-coming partners in new markets. Its innovative and reliable solutions have been part of more than 1,600 reference projects worldwide.

Job Description
  • Leads and coordinates all engineering activities for the project, ensuring alignment among various teams and reporting to the Project Director.
  • Acts as the primary technical liaison with customers, consortium partners, consultants, and authorities.
  • Understands technical requirements and implements the Project Execution Strategy, Project Procurement Strategy, and Project Quality Plan in engineering activities.
  • Develops and maintains the project schedule, ensuring completion within contractual dates, and oversees the preparation and deployment of the Engineering documentation.
  • Ensures robust design freezes, proper quality control through quality gate review processes, and effective management of changes via the Design Change Request (DCR) process.
  • Maintains close contact with the site team during construction and commissioning, resolving engineering issues and ensuring timely provision of required inputs.
  • Develops cooperative relationships with the client and consortium partner, identifies and mitigates risks, and manages the handover process to the Warranty team, ensuring all inputs are provided to minimize issues.
  • Travelling up to 10 - 20 %
